About the Sri Kodandarama Swamy Temple

The Sri Kodandarama Swamy Temple celebrates Lord Rama, his consort Sita, and brother Lakshmana. According to legend, this temple marks the spot where Lord Rama, along with Sita and Lakshmana, stayed during their exile. This connection makes the temple a significant pilgrimage site, attracting thousands of devotees each year.

Temple Timings

The temple opens for darshan early in the morning at 5:00 AM and continues until 9:00 PM, providing ample time for devotees to offer prayers and seek blessings.

Opening and Closing Hours

The temple starts its day with the Suprabhatham Seva at 5:00 AM, marking the opening time. The temple then remains open for darshan until 9:00 PM, accommodating devotees throughout the day.

Break Timings

While the temple remains open for most of the day, it’s essential to note that different sources indicate varying break timings. It’s advisable for devotees to check the exact break timings on the day of their visit to avoid any inconvenience.

Pooja Schedule

The temple conducts various poojas throughout the day, starting with the Suprabhatham Seva early in the morning. The Kalyanotsavam, a significant ritual at the temple, takes place daily from 11 AM to 12 PM.
